The context

Bodo/Glimt have been in fine scoring form in this competition, netting 11 goals in 4 matches without a single defeat, boasting 2 wins and 2 draws. Club Brugge, meanwhile, will be keen to leverage their home advantage and respond to the visitors' attacking threat.
